Now it's understandable to be skepticle after Mercury Steams shitty Castlevania games, but keep this in mind regarding Samus Returns:
>Directed and level design by Takehiko Hosokawa, who did the level design for Zero Mission and Fusion
>Produced by Yoshio Sakamoto, who has overseen every Metroid besides II
>Soundtrack by Kenji Yamamoto and Minako Hamano, who did the soundtracks for previous Metroid games
>General development and design is by people over at Nintendo EPD
It has been confirmed that Mercury Steam are pretty much nothing but code monkeys for this game, as well as suggesting SOME creative ideas that NINTENDO refine and work with.
This is going to be a fantastic, fantastic game that Metroid fans have been wanting for 13 years.

I'm not buying the switch because of the paid online but to be fair to them they've changed the game of the month model to a better system. Closer to what Playstation does.
>Nintendo's plans for retro games have also changed. No longer will subscribers be limited to a single game per month - instead, those who pay into Nintendo Switch Online will be granted an all-you-can-play buffet. As the company told Kotaku, "Nintendo Switch Online subscribers will have ongoing access to a library of classic games with added online play. Users can play as many of the games as they want, as often as they like, as long as they have an active subscription."
